The rain finally got the better of my binos and then me, which was disappointing b/c stuff was happening. Wish I could have birded longer. Some:

NASHVILLE Warbler (1)
BLACK and WHITE (4)
PRAIRIE (1)
BLUE-WINGED (2, not singing)
(and yellow rump)

Blue-Headed Vireo (2)
Few more: house wrens, brown thrasher, gnatcatchers, phoebe, the usual.

The Nashville was most fun--I heard something unusual amid a chorus of a couple dozen or more goldfinches. Then saw different behavior--and got it. Soon after, the rain was too much.
